项目方案:基于Python的交叉循环数据分析工具

简介

在数据分析领域中,经常需要对两个参数进行交叉循环分析,以便得出相关的统计结果。本项目将开发一个基于Python的数据分析工具,实现两个参数的交叉循环分析,并提供可视化结果展示,以帮助用户更好地理解数据间的关系。

实现方案

  1. 数据准备:首先,我们需要准备数据集,包括两个参数的值以及相应的数据。可以使用pandas库来读取和处理数据,将数据存储在DataFrame中。

    import pandas as pd
    
    # 读取数据
    df = pd.read_csv('data.csv')
    
  2. 交叉循环分析:接下来,我们可以使用嵌套循环来对两个参数进行交叉循环分析,计算相关的统计结果。比如计算两个参数的相关性、均值或其他统计指标。

    for param1 in df['parameter1'].unique():
        for param2 in df['parameter2'].unique():
            subset = df[(df['parameter1'] == param1) & (df['parameter2'] == param2)]
            # 进行统计分析
    
  3. 可视化展示:最后,我们可以使用matplotlibseaborn等库来将分析结果可视化展示,方便用户直观地理解数据间的关系。

    import matplotlib.pyplot as plt
    
    plt.scatter(x=subset['parameter1'], y=subset['parameter2'])
    plt.xlabel('Parameter 1')
    plt.ylabel('Parameter 2')
    plt.title('Scatter Plot of Parameter 1 and Parameter 2')
    plt.show()
    

项目优势

  • 灵活性:用户可以根据具体需求自定义交叉循环分析的方法和统计指标。
  • 可扩展性:项目可以扩展到多参数交叉循环分析,满足更复杂的数据分析需求。
  • 直观性:通过可视化展示,用户可以更直观地理解数据之间的关系,发现潜在规律。

结尾

通过以上方案,我们可以开发出一个基于Python的交叉循环数据分析工具,帮助用户更好地理解数据间的关系并做出有效的决策。同时,项目具有灵活性、可扩展性和直观性等优势,适用于各种数据分析场景。希望本项目能够为数据分析工作者提供便利,帮助他们更好地挖掘数据的潜力。